Outdoor Drain Installation in Tuscaloosa, AL
Outdoor drain installation services involve designing and installing drainage systems to manage excess water around a property. These projects typically include the placement of underground drains, catch basins, and piping to direct rainwater away from foundations, walkways, driveways, and landscaping. Homeowners often request this service to prevent water pooling, reduce the risk of basement flooding, and protect landscaping investments, especially in areas prone to heavy rainfall or poor natural drainage.
Before requesting outdoor drain installation, property owners should consider the layout of their yard, existing drainage issues, and the desired water flow direction. It’s helpful to understand the scope of the project, including the types of drainage components suitable for the property’s terrain and the potential need for permits or inspections. Clear communication about specific drainage concerns and property features can ensure an effective solution that minimizes water-related problems and enhances overall property resilience.

Common Outdoor Drain Installation Jobs
Outdoor Drain Installation - Proper drainage systems help prevent water pooling and property damage.
French Drains - These drains redirect excess groundwater away from foundations and landscaping.
Surface Drains - Surface drains collect rainwater runoff from driveways and walkways effectively.
Catch Basins - Catch basins trap debris and prevent clogging in outdoor drainage systems.
Drainage Channel Installation - Channels guide water flow to designated drainage areas for efficient runoff management.
Stormwater Drainage - Designed to handle heavy rain, stormwater drainage protects property from flooding.
Outdoor Drain Installation Questions
What is outdoor drain installation? It involves setting up drainage systems to direct water away from property foundations, preventing water pooling and damage.
What types of outdoor drains are commonly installed? Popular options include trench drains, catch basins, and French drains, each suited for different drainage needs.
Why is proper outdoor drain installation important? Correct installation helps prevent basement flooding, soil erosion, and landscape damage caused by excess water.
What projects typically require outdoor drain installation? Common projects include yard drainage, driveway runoff management, and preventing water accumulation around foundations.
